Vibrant Matters

Vibrant Matters documents the final works of second-year Painting/Printmaking MFA students at Yale University. The catalog is divided into five sections, each separated by colored pages printed with two layers of white pigment. The cover features screen printing on both sides of fine paper, while the inner pages have an orange gradient. The outer pages are printed with a mix of pearl pigments, colors, and varnishes for a reflective effect, complementing the pale blue of the paper. The cover is also debossed. The book is quite heavy and bound with five screws. The text is printed using UV printing on coated paper, making it stand out on the surface. Both the catalog and the students’ artwork were exhibited at Jeffrey Deitch gallery in New York.
